High Temperature of Photovoltaic Cable Trays

High Temperature of Photovoltaic Cable Trays

Death Valley in the Mojave Desert holds the official record for the hottest place on Earth at 134°F. Low-carbon steel easily outperforms both fiberglass and aluminum in extremely hot environments. Solar photovoltaic (PV) plants in hot climates—such as deserts or tropical regions—experience extreme ambient and operating temperatures that stress DC cables. Cables exposed on rooftops or ground mounts can reach surface temperatures exceeding 80-90°C, impacting current-carrying capacity. Principle of Small Busbar in High Voltage Distribution Cabinet

Principle of Small Busbar in High Voltage Distribution Cabinet

The busbar acts as a low-resistance path that carries electrical current from one point to several circuits. Voltage drop is well known to electrical engineers and is defined by Ohm's Law and the simplest of equations: V = I × R. An electric busbar (also written as bus bar) is a metallic bar, strip, tube, or rod that conducts current from one place to another in a safe manner with minimal energy losses.
